Manchester United transfer news: Senegal star Kalidou Koulibaly wants Napoli exit in £95m deal

Koulibaly, 27, is said to be open on the idea of leaving Italy after the recent racism incident in a Serie A fixture against Internazionale.

According to reports in Italy, the French-born defender notified the club he would like to open contract talks with United.

This after The Red Devils interest was previously confirmed by Napoli president Aurelio De Laurentiis - which would've ranked as the world-record transfer for a defender.

"[Jose] Mourinho wanted him, we rejected £95million," De Laurentiis said in December, as per Calcio Mercato. "But now [after Mourinho's sacking] it's impossible that he leaves Napoli."

However, that has not appeared to deter United and reports on Tuesday claimed the club had renewed attempts to land the centre-half and were indeed ready to test Napoli’s resolve to keep a player who only signed a new five-year deal at the club in September.

English publication Metro stated Koulibaly has been notified that his current £80,000 a week wages would be doubled if he were to arrive at Old Trafford. 

However, De Laurentiis is adamant he won’t be sold this month and wants the player to form the cornerstone of their bid to win the Europa League – a competition he believes the club can win.
